The metathesis catalyst 1 allows the first living cyclopolymerization of 1,6‐heptadiynes. With the chiral 4‐(ethoxycarbonyl)‐4‐(1 S ,2 R ,5 S )‐(+)‐menthoxycarbonyl‐1,6‐heptadiyne highly tactic polymers with an alternating cis–trans structure and a stereoregularity of greater than 95 % are obtained. Fixation of 1 on poly(2‐oxazoline) block copolymers provides access to poly(acetylene)s under aqueous conditions by micellar catalysis.
